IKEA PROMOTES BIGGEST CANADIAN STORE TO DATE
By Adnews Staff
Ikea Canada, based in Burlington, ON, opened its largest Canadian store yesterday in Coquitlam, BC. The Swedish home furnishing retailer currently operates nine stores in Canada. The Coquitlam location is built on 15 acres of land and has a shopping area about 120,000 square feet in size. Television, newspaper and transit advertising, created by Carmichael Lynch of Minneapolis, is promoting the opening of the store. Various promotional give-aways are also planned, including a $5,000 shopping spree for the first person in line and $50 gift certificates for the first 22 sets of twins to visit the store. The twins promotion is intended to tie the Coquitlam store with Ikea Richmond, the oldest Ikea store in North America. The grand opening advertising campaign will run over a ten-day period.
